Transaction 15d4ebafff7177d6b57dab750750c125391c1ac1aada29e97c02a4d822b42faa
1 Input
2 Outputs
- 15d4ebafff7177d6b57dab750750c125391c1ac1aada29e97c02a4d822b42faa:0
- 15d4ebafff7177d6b57dab750750c125391c1ac1aada29e97c02a4d822b42faa:1
value 14000000
address 3BAbA7oEKrjS1iZKTkm1umQ4vC5KNERB1N
value 9289
address 1Hwso4BqVBguktE7UdhLnPoSwtfwPxy8sy